 Siezed Taper Lock
I removed my lower unit from my GTR35 to replace the shaft seals. I am trying to remove the taper lock bushing from the pulley and shaft, but can't get it to budge. I removed the two allen head bolts and put one of them in the third hole and tightened it down, but it didn't move. I am afraid to put too much pressure on it and strip the threads so I have been soaking it in liquid wrench and my next thought is to try heating up the pulley. Any other recommendations or ideas?
